Medals/Scholarships
  • A student who tops in aggregate in any annual 1st, 2nd, 3rd or final professional examination in the university shall be awarded a Gold Medal
  • A student who stands IInd in aggregate in any annual 1st, 2nd, 3rd or final professional examination in the university shall be awarded a silver medal.
  •  A student who tops in university in any subject of 1st, 2nd, 3rd or final professional examination in the university shall be awarded a gold medal.
  • A student who stands IInd in any subject of 1st, 2nd, 3rd or final professional examination in the university shall be awarded a silver medal.
  • Students who stand Ist in aggregate of all the four university examinations shall be declared as the Best Grade and be awarded a Gold Medal. Such a student must pass all the annual examinations in first attempt.
  • No medal is awarded to any student for standing 1st or 2nd in aggregate or in individual subject in the supplementary examination even if it is his/her 1st attempt.
  • A prize for Excellence in clinical work shall be awarded to final year students on the recommendation of committee comprising the heads of clinical Dental subjects.
  • A college colour shall be awarded to a student who excels in sports in the college university state or national level.
  • A scholarship of Rs. 10000/- shall be awarded to any students who tops in any annual University examinations in aggregate.
  • In addition to the above a certain no. of poor and deserving students may be awarded cash scholarship or part fee concession on the recommendation of the college council
  • Students who stand first in the college in any final exam in aggregate shall be awarded a "Scholar Badge".
Migration
  • Migration from one dental college to other is not a right of a student. However, migration of students from one dental college to another dental college in India may be considered by  the Dental Council  of  India.  Only in exceptional cases on extreme compassionate ground*, provided following criteria are fulfilled. Routine migrations on other ground shall not be allowed.
  • Both the colleges, i.e. one at which the student is studying at present and one to which migration is sought, are recognized by the Dental Council of India.
  • The applicant candidate should have passed first professional BDS examination.
  • The  applicant candidate submits his application for  migration, complete in all  respects, to all  authorities concerned  within a period of  one month of  passing  (declaration of  results) the first professional Bachelor of  Dental Surgery  (BDS)  examination .
  • The applicant candidate must submit &n affidavit stating that he/ she _  will  pursue  240 days  of  prescribed study  before appeart.-1g at 2nd professional Bachelor of  Dental Surgery (BDS)  examination at the transferee dental college, which should ;be  duly certified by  the Registrar of  the concerned  University in  which he/she  is seeking transfer. The transfer will be applicable only after. Receipt of the affidavit.

    Note 1:  ยท
    - Migration is permitted  only in  the beginning of  2nd year BDS Course in  recognized Institution.
    - All applications for  migrate Of\ shall be referred to  Dental Council of India by  college authorities. No Institution/University shall allow migrations directly without the prior approval of the Council.
    - Council reserved the right, not to entertain any application which is  not  under the prescribed compassionate  grounds  and also  to  take independent  decisions where applicant has been allowed to  migrate without referring the same to the Council.

    Note 2: *Compassionate ground criteria: (i)  Death of supporting guardian.
    - Disturbed conditions as declared by Government in  the Dental College area .
